A CONCURRENT RESOLUTION

TO REQUEST THAT THE DEPARTMENT OF TRANSPORTATION NAME THE INTERSECTION OF SOUTH CAROLINA HIGHWAY 72 AND WILLARD ROAD IN GREENWOOD COUNTY "JIMMY BRITT INTERSECTION" AND ERECT APPROPRIATE MARKERS OR SIGNS AT THIS INTERSECTION THAT CONTAIN THE WORDS "JIMMY BRITT INTERSECTION".

Whereas, Mr. James W. "Jimmy" Britt was born on June 28, 1932, in McCormick County and died on March 2, 2011; and

Whereas, he was a graduate of Greenwood High School who served his country with honor and distinction during the Korean War; and

Whereas, he served as President of Britt Construction Company and was the owner and operator of Blazer's Restaurant; and

Whereas, Mr. Britt was a member of the American Legion Post 20, served as President of the Greenwood Homebuilder's Association, President of the South Carolina Hospitality Association, and Director of the National Restaurant Association; and

Whereas, he was a faithful member of Main Street Methodist Church; and

Whereas, he and his wife Norma together raised five wonderful children; and

Whereas, it would be fitting and proper to pay tribute to the legacy of this son of South Carolina by naming an intersection in Greenwood County in his honor. Now, therefore,

Be it resolved by the House of Representatives, the Senate concurring:

That the members of the General Assembly request that the Department of Transportation name the intersection of South Carolina Highway 72 and Willard Road in Greenwood County "Jimmy Britt Intersection" and erect appropriate markers or signs at this intersection that contain the words "Jimmy Britt Intersection".

Be it further resolved that a copy of this resolution be forwarded to the Department of Transportation.
